Walkway washing services involve the thorough cleaning of outdoor pathways, including concrete, brick, stone, or paver surfaces that lead to a property’s entrance. This process typically uses high-pressure water or specialized cleaning equipment to remove dirt, algae, moss, stains, and grime that accumulate over time. Regular walkway washing can restore the appearance of a property’s exterior, making walkways look fresh and well-maintained. Many service providers also offer additional treatments to eliminate slippery moss or algae, helping to improve safety for residents and visitors alike.
Over time, walkways can develop a buildup of dirt, mold, and algae, which can make surfaces look dull and unkempt. In some cases, staining from leaves, oil, or other substances can also diminish curb appeal. Walkway washing helps address these issues by deep-cleaning the surfaces, removing stubborn stains, and restoring their original appearance. This service can be especially beneficial for homeowners preparing to sell their property or those who want to maintain a clean, inviting entrance. Regular cleaning can also prevent the buildup of mold and algae, which can make surfaces slippery and potentially hazardous.

The overview below groups typical Walkway Washing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Palmetto,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Walkway Cleaning - Typical costs range from $150 to $400 for routine washing of residential walkways. Many standard j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the length and material of the walkway. Fewer projects reach the higher end, which may involve additional surface treatments.
Pressure Washing for Larger Areas - Larger walkways or commercial properties often cost between $400 and $1,200. These projects can vary based on size and complexity, with most falling in the lower to mid part of this range. Larger, more detailed jobs can push costs higher.
Deep Cleaning or Stain Removal - Deep cleaning or stain removal services typically cost $200 to $600. Many projects in this category are moderate in scope, with fewer requiring extensive treatments that can increase the price significantly.
Full Walkway Replacement - Complete replacement of a walkway can range from $2,500 to $5,000 or more, depending on size and materials. Most projects are in the lower to mid-range, with only larger or more complex installations reaching the higher end of this sp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are walkway washing services? Walkway washing services involve cleaning exterior pathways, such as concrete, brick, or stone surfaces, to remove dirt, stains, algae, and debris for improved appearance and safety.
Why should I consider professional walkway washing? Professional walkway washing can effectively remove stubborn dirt and stains, enhance curb appeal, and prevent surface deterioration caused by buildup over time.
What types of walkways can local contractors clean? Local service providers can clean various types of walkways, including concrete, brick, pavers, and stone surfaces around residential and commercial properties.
How do local contractors typically perform walkway washing? They usually use pressure washing equipment combined with suitable cleaning solutions to efficiently clean and restore walkway surfaces.
Are walkway washing services suitable for all weather conditions? Walkway washing is generally performed in suitable weather conditions to ensure effective cleaning and drying, with local contractors advising on the best timing based on the weather.
